eFlex Assembly is a an end-to-end solution for medium to complex assembly with model variability. It is a Microsoft .NET-based, easy-to-use flexible assembly process configuration tool that tightly synchronizes activity between the ERP layer and automation on the plant floor by executing a fast, accurate and repeatable rebalancing of PLC-controlled interlocked assembly workstation lines using the customer’s component assembly process information.
Using eFlex Assembly, process owners can deploy process flows to specific work stations throughout the flexible assembly system structure, without recoding or bringing the system down. The eFlex Assembly user interface screens hide the complexity of flexible assembly system logic, enabling you to work at the highest level of the process using “best practice” process templates without being exposed to the controls engineering hard coding for the flexible assembly system.
